Book Description
The material contained in this document is taken from the POST basic course. A committee made up of reserve and basic course trainers developed this material to provide uniformity in reserve training on a statewide basis. The material contained in this document minimally covers the requirements for reserve level II training and is intended as a guideline for coordinator's and instructor's use.

Book Description
AMPHIBIOUS WARFARE LETTER OF PROMULGATION This curriculum guide builds upon the work of many contributors. Intellectual rigor and academic standards demand that the full scope of amphibious warfare be encompassed rather than the tracing of Marine Corps History emphasizing the landings of the Great Pacific War which had forged our modern Corps. The present course structure and content reflect the determination that (1) the history of amphibious warfare remains a valid intellectual endeavor; (2) its scope greatly exceeds the study of the U.S. Marine Corps; and (3) a historical survey of amphibious warfare is best approached from a “Maneuver Warfare” perspective, exploring the various levels of war and their impact on each battle. The levels of war would include the political, strategic, operational, and tactical/technical. This construct of classes will also prepare students to become critical thinkers of warfare, and thus better prepare them for future commissioned service to the Marine Corps. Instructors are cautioned to observe that this manual contains lesson guides, not lesson plans. Instructors must devote time for serious background reading in recommended literature, course texts, and contemplation of a conceptual approach that will capture the imagination of their students. Another important objective of this course must be to stimulate original thought and persistent interest on the part of the student. PROFESSIONAL CORE COMPETENCY OBJECTIVES The primary objectives of this course are to provide prospective merchant marine officers a basic understanding of their role in our national security and to familiarize them with the basic principles and procedures for operating amerchant ship as a naval or military auxiliary in a wartime convoy or independent sailing situation.

Book Description
The objective of this document is to identify the instructional goals, training topics, learning activities, test descriptions, and instructional hour standards that comprise the required content of the module D course. Certain instructional topics that are delivered in the "Training specifications for the regular basic course" have been omitted in these specifications for module D to avoid unnecessary redundancy in curriculum. This is based on the instructional delivery of this curriculum in reserve modules A, B, and C. These modules are prerequisites to attendance of reserve module D.
